I have developed a Mono/.Net 4.0 C# application using MonoDevelop. Things are
running fine on my Ubuntu 14.10 (32-bit) OS.
On deploying on Windows 2003 server, with .Net 4.0 and Mono-3.2.3 with
gtksharp 2.12.11, the application crashed after running for about 4-5 mins.
There was no error display. I checked the WIndows Event Viewer and found
this:
Event Type:     Error
Event Source:   Application Error
Event Category: (100)
Event ID:       1000
Date:           23.01.2015
Time:           13:13:09
User:           N/A
Computer:       ----
Description:
Faulting application mono.exe, version 0.0.0.0, faulting module
libgtk-win32-2.0-0.dll, version 2.24.0.0, fault address 0x00172214.

The application is using GLib.Timeout for calling a new ThreadHandler, in
which files are uploading to a FTP location.
There is no specific time when it crashes, sometimes it crashes without any
operation, sometimes after a Thread is completed.
